DNA damage and apoptosis in the mussel Mytilus galloprovincialis
Authors:Micić Milena  Bihari Nevenka  Jaksić Zeljko  Müller Werner E G  Batel Renato
Institution:Center for Marine Research, Rudjer Boskovi? Institute, Rovinj, Croatia. micic@cim.irb.hr
Abstract:The effects of known genotoxic substances (4-nitroquinoline-N-oxide, benzoa]pyrene, teniposide, etoposide, cycloheximide, tributyltin) on human cells (FLC, HL-60) and on mussels were investigated. The correlations between formation of DNA strand breaks and DNA fragmentation characteristic for the process of apoptosis were estimated. Strand breaks induced by 4-nitroquinoline-N-oxide and benzoa]pyrene did not correlate with DNA fragmentation detected in the process of apoptosis. Induction of internucleosomal DNA fragmentation in HL-60 cells was initiated by teniposide, etoposide and tributyltin, while in the gills of mussels this was detected only with tributyltin. Levels of DNA strand breaks in natural mussel populations, living at locations under the influence of urban and industrial wastes, do not mirror the apoptotic processes.
